Synopsis
Thoma Bravo, a software investment firm, agreed to acquire portions of Digital Aviation Solutions business from Boeing, a global aerospace company, for $10.55bn. "We are proud to be investing in such an important technology platform in the broader aerospace and defense industry. With a heritage dating back to the 1930s, Jeppesen has been at the forefront of technological innovation for nearly a century. We are excited to build on this track record and power its next phase of growth," Holden Spaht, Thoma Bravo Managing Partner.
